52a19c82608c1bd1532df4492896112451586dce03b521ce9a08623d607ca7ea.pngAlthough forecasts remain generally optimistic, some analysts are pointing to signs that may indicate an imminent reversal. These signs involve divergences between price movement and key technical indicators.

A divergence occurs when the price reaches a new high, while technical indicators or related metrics begin to weaken. This usually signals a loss of momentum. Currently, Bitcoin is showing several such warning signs.

Divergences suggest a possible Bitcoin correction
The first concerning signal has appeared on the monthly chart. These timeframes often go unnoticed, as most traders focus on daily movements and miss the bigger picture. But right now, the monthly view clearly warrants attention.

According to 10xResearch, Bitcoin has once again hit a critical level and is behaving in a suspiciously similar way to what was seen in 2021. Back then, the fae9f1d30b0fcc7ad799937343b9ba487a5c99ead753cb6fe18c6cdc4123e2ac.pngprice reached the top twice, with the second peak higher than the first. A similar pattern is now forming on the chart.

 

Bitcoin resistance in 2021 and 2025. Source: 10xResearch

In addition, analyst Matthew Hyland has identified a bearish divergence in the RSI on the weekly chart. Analyst Mitch Ray also noted a confirmed divergence on the daily timeframe — this time using the MACD-H indicator.

These technical chart signals suggest that Bitcoin’s growth momentum is slowing down. If the market continues in this direction, a noticeable correction could occur within the next few weeks.

One of the more unconventional indicators highlighted by analyst James Van Straten is the divergence in behavior between Bitcoin and MicroStrategy (MSTR) stock.1ed4ab6b95f102b93c6048eba541143e59984d3db48ce8ee24c589c9911893fc.png

                  Bitcoin price vs. MicroStrategy stock. Source: James Van Straten

 

Van Straten pointed out that a similar situation occurred in 2021: back then, MicroStrategy's stock plummeted by nearly 50%, while Bitcoin simultaneously reached its all-time high of $69,000. Now, we’re seeing something similar — MSTR shares are again down 50% from their peak, yet BTC continues to rise, recently breaking above $111,000. The imbalance between the two is becoming increasingly evident.

Although James Van Straten didn’t provide a direct forecast, he believes the current setup resembles the early phase of a market reversal, much like the 2021–2022 cycle.

According to a 10xResearch report:

“Bitcoin closed the month at a high price, but beneath the surface, warning signs are growing. We see divergence between price, volatility, and retail behavior. Major players like MicroStrategy have reduced activity, key altcoins are losing support, volumes are falling, and momentum is weakening. All of this strongly resembles the final stage of the 2021 rally.”

That said, not all metrics point to a downturn. Interest in Bitcoin is growing among companies that previously had little to do with crypto — including those from the gaming, healthcare, and retail sectors. Bitwise forecasts that institutional investments could reach $426.9 billion by 2026, potentially acquiring up to 20% of Bitcoin’s total supply.

These new participants may be the key difference between the current market and that of 2021, suggesting that direct comparisons between cycles may not be entirely accurate.
